Nov 08, 2009 21:28 |  #3

eh.... lol... it was a dome.. its was barely useable for college football... 1/500th 1600 2.8 for the majority.. I could squeeze 1/640th at midfield but the endzones I was at 1/400th- 1/500th. Ill have to get used to it. Later this month I am going up to St. Louis to shoot the state football championships in the edward jones dome. apparently it is slightly better...

bnorm27 wrote in post #8982329 (external link)
I would hope the lighting there would be better. All the NJ championship games are outdoors, some at night. Small Division 3 college fields for some, Giants Stadium for a few.

Hey norm. Just saw your post ... make sure you contact the NJSIAA and get an official pass for these games. If you go to Giants Stadium, there is a process of submitting paper work. Otherwise you will get no where near the field or press area.

Kean College is a bit easier, but I would make sure I contact the state.

As for South Jersey teams, I am not sure where those games are hosted.
